Transaction 126961c4f8ffce7ad16709e417035293a998cf827a13852297ecd011e1e58df5

2 Input
1 Outputs
  • 126961c4f8ffce7ad16709e417035293a998cf827a13852297ecd011e1e58df5:0
  • value  466399
    address  3EUkKhbxQWcKTJntHVGrSgto1SSTV4z8tn